文档介绍:一、选择题(每题2分,共30分)?(C)A)))):(A)A).aspxB)asaxC)ascxD)asmx3、.mand对象的ExecuteReader方法返回一个:(B)A)XmlReaderB)SqlDataReaderC)SqlDataAdapterD)DataSet4、下面那一个不能作为C#中类修饰符?(D)A)newB)public、privateC)protected、internalD)overrideE)abstract、sealed5、.NET框架中,File对象的OpenText方法,将返回一个:(A)A)StreamReader对象B)StreamWriter对象C)Stream对象D)File对象6、以下哪些不是C#的关键字?(B)A)finallyB)importC)interfaceD)unsafeE)sbyte7、以下代码片断(B)strings="1234567";stringss=(3,3);returnss;的返回值是(D)A)“1234”B)“4567”C)“12345”D)“1237”8、异常是由try来处理,以下那种处理形式不正确(B)A)try—catch(s)B)try---throwC)try---finallyD)try—catch(s)---finally9、对代理的声明方法不正确的有:(D)A)delegateintd();B)delegateintd(inti);publicdelegateint(inti);D)deleageintd;[A(“temp”)]delegateintd(inti);10、假定有一个类A,类A中定义一个方法staticvoidf();a1是A的一个对象,则下面对f的引用那一个正确(A):()B)()C)f()D)都不正确11、接口可以包含一个和多个成员,下面哪个选项不能包含在接口中DA)方法、属性B)索引指示器C)事件D)常量、域12、接口不能通过(C)来实现A)类B)结构C)方法13、下面那一个不是C#中方法的参数的类型(E)A)值类型B)引用型C)输出型D)数组型E)代理型14、C#中的数据类型分为简单类型和引用类型,下面那一个不属于引用类型(E)A)类B)代表C)数组D)接口E)枚举15、下面对属性的格式描述正确的是:(A)A)只读属性B)只写属性publicstringNamepublicstringName{{getget{{returnname;name=value;}}}}C)只读只写属性D)只读只写属性publicstringNamepublicstringName{{getget{{returnname;publicstringName}returnname;}}publicstringNameset{{setname=value;{name=value;}}}}二、程序填空(每空2分,共10分)下面是代理使用方法的描述,请根据提示把代码补充完整。明一个代理,名称为d,带有两个参数,分别为整型变量i,j。delegateintd(inti,intj);lassMyClass{p